Assessment of sentinel Lymph node mapping with different volumes of Indocyanine green in early-stage ENdometrial cancer: the ALIEN study. Int J Gynecol Cancer 2024; 34:824-829. Abstract
OBJECTIVE To evaluate the impact of different volumes of indocyanine green (ICG) on the detection rate and bilateral mapping of sentinel lymph nodes in patients with apparent uterine-confined endometrial cancer. METHODS All patients who underwent surgical staging with sentinel node mapping in six reference centers were included. Two different protocols of ICG intracervical injection were used: (1) 2 mL group: total volume of 2 mL injected superficially; (2) 4 mL group: total volume of 4 mL, 2 mL deeply and 2 mL superficially. Logistic regression was used to analyze factors that could influence dye migration and detection rates. A sensitivity analysis was carried out to determine how independent variables could affect the sentinel node detection rate. RESULTS Of 442 eligible patients, 352 were analyzed (172 in the 2 mL group and 180 in the 4 mL group). The bilateral detection rates of the 2 mL and 4 mL groups were 84.9% and 86.1%, respectively (p=0.76). The overall detection rate was higher with a volume of 4 mL than with 2 mL (97.8% vs 92.4%, respectively; p=0.024). In the univariate analysis the rate of bilateral mapping fell from 87.5% to 73.5% when the International Federation of Gynecology and Obstetrics (FIGO) 2009 tumor stage was >IB (p=0.018). In the multivariate analysis, for both overall and bilateral detection rates a statistically significant difference emerged for the volume of ICG injected and FIGO 2009 stage >IB. Increasing body mass index was associated with worse overall detection rates on univariate analysis (p=0.0006), and significantly decreased from 97% to 91% when the body mass index exceeded 30 kg/m2 (p=0.05). CONCLUSIONS In patients with early-stage endometrial cancer, a volume of 2 mL ICG does not seem to compromise the bilateral detection of sentinel lymph nodes. In women with obesity and FIGO 2009 stage >IB, a 4 mL injection should be preferred.

Consensus on surgical technique for sentinel lymph node dissection in cervical cancer. Int J Gynecol Cancer 2024; 34:504-509. Abstract
OBJECTIVE The purpose of this study was to establish a consensus on the surgical technique for sentinel lymph node (SLN) dissection in cervical cancer. METHODS A 26 question survey was emailed to international expert gynecological oncology surgeons. A two-step modified Delphi method was used to establish consensus. After a first round of online survey, the questions were amended and a second round, along with semistructured interviews was performed. Consensus was defined using a 70% cut-off for agreement. RESULTS Twenty-five of 38 (65.8%) experts responded to the first and second rounds of the online survey. Agreement ≥70% was reached for 13 (50.0%) questions in the first round and for 15 (57.7%) in the final round. Consensus agreement identified 15 recommended, three optional, and five not recommended steps. Experts agreed on the following recommended procedures: use of indocyanine green as a tracer; superficial (with or without deep) injection at 3 and 9 o'clock; injection at the margins of uninvolved mucosa avoiding vaginal fornices; grasping the cervix with forceps only in part of the cervix is free of tumor; use of a minimally invasive approach for SLN biopsy in the case of simple trachelectomy/conization; identification of the ureter, obliterated umbilical artery, and external iliac vessels before SLN excision; commencing the dissection at the level of the uterine artery and continuing laterally; and completing dissection in one hemi-pelvis before proceeding to the contralateral side. Consensus was also reached in recommending against injection at 6 and 12 o'clock, and injection directly into the tumor in cases of the tumor completely replacing the cervix; against removal of nodes through port without protective maneuvers; absence of an ultrastaging protocol; and against modifying tracer concentration at the time of re-injection after mapping failure. CONCLUSION Recommended, optional, and not recommended steps of SLN dissection in cervical cancer have been identified based on consensus among international experts. These represent a surgical guide that may be used by surgeons in clinical trials and for quality assurance in routine practice.

Indocyanine green-guided sentinel lymph node mapping during laparoscopic surgery with vaginal cuff closure but no uterine manipulator for cervical cancer. Int J Clin Oncol 2022; 27:1499-1506. Abstract
BACKGROUND Lymph node metastasis is a critical prognostic factor in cervical cancer. Considering the potential complications of lymphadenectomy and desirability of avoiding systemic lymphadenectomy, accurate intraoperative prediction of the existence of lymph node metastasis is important in patients undergoing surgery for cervical cancer. We evaluated the feasibility and value of indocyanine green (ICG) use for sentinel lymph node (SLN) mapping during laparoscopic surgery performed for cervical cancer. METHODS This single-center cohort study included 77 patients undergoing a new laparoscopic radical surgery method with pelvic lymphadenectomy for early-stage cervical cancer. The surgery, performed without using a uterine manipulator, included creation of a vaginal cuff. Bilateral ICG-guided SLN mapping and rapid histopathological examination were performed, and results were analyzed in relation to final histopathologic diagnoses. RESULTS The SLN pelvic side-specific detection rate was 93.5%, sensitivity (SLN-positive cases/SLN-detected pelvic lymph node-positive cases) was 100%, intraoperative negative predictive value (NPV) was 97.8%, and final pathological NPV was 100%. The detection rate was significantly lower for tumors ≥ 2 cm in diameter than for tumors < 2 cm in diameter. Micrometastases were missed by intraoperative examination in 3 cases. CONCLUSION The high NPV suggests the feasibility and usefulness of ICG-based SLN mapping plus rapid intraoperative examination for identification of metastatic SLNs. Use of ICG-based mapping for intraoperative identification of SLNs in patients undergoing this new laparoscopic surgery method for early-stage cervical cancer was particularly effective for tumors < 2 cm in diameter. However, incorporating a search for micrometastases into rapid intraoperative histopathologic examination may be necessary.

European Society of Gynaecological Oncology quality indicators for the surgical treatment of endometrial carcinoma. Int J Gynecol Cancer 2021; 31:1508-1529. Abstract
BACKGROUND Quality of surgical care as a crucial component of a comprehensive multi-disciplinary management improves outcomes in patients with endometrial carcinoma, notably helping to avoid suboptimal surgical treatment. Quality indicators (QIs) enable healthcare professionals to measure their clinical management with regard to ideal standards of care. OBJECTIVE In order to complete its set of QIs for the surgical management of gynecological cancers, the European Society of Gynaecological Oncology (ESGO) initiated the development of QIs for the surgical treatment of endometrial carcinoma. METHODS QIs were based on scientific evidence and/or expert consensus. The development process included a systematic literature search for the identification of potential QIs and documentation of the scientific evidence, two consensus meetings of a group of international experts, an internal validation process, and external review by a large international panel of clinicians and patient representatives. QIs were defined using a structured format comprising metrics specifications, and targets. A scoring system was then developed to ensure applicability and feasibility of a future ESGO accreditation process based on these QIs for endometrial carcinoma surgery and support any institutional or governmental quality assurance programs. RESULTS Twenty-nine structural, process and outcome indicators were defined. QIs 1-5 are general indicators related to center case load, training, experience of the surgeon, structured multi-disciplinarity of the team and active participation in clinical research. QIs 6 and 7 are related to the adequate pre-operative investigations. QIs 8-22 are related to peri-operative standards of care. QI 23 is related to molecular markers for endometrial carcinoma diagnosis and as determinants for treatment decisions. QI 24 addresses the compliance of management of patients after primary surgical treatment with the standards of care. QIs 25-29 highlight the need for a systematic assessment of surgical morbidity and oncologic outcome as well as standardized and comprehensive documentation of surgical and pathological elements. Each QI was associated with a score. An assessment form including a scoring system was built as basis for ESGO accreditation of centers for endometrial cancer surgery.

Larish A, Mariani A, Langstraat C. Controversies in the Management of Early-stage Serous Endometrial Cancer. In Vivo 2021; 35:671-680. Abstract
BACKGROUND/AIM Early-stage uterine serous carcinoma (USC) has one of the highest recurrence rates and mortality among early-stage uterine epithelial cancers. Research into the clinical management of USC has begun to progress, guided by surgical and pathological advances. This article summarizes the available literature regarding diagnosis, management, and possible future uses of molecular analysis of women with early-stage USC. MATERIALS AND METHODS PubMed was searched for all pertinent English language research articles published from January 1, 2006 through March 1, 2020 which included a study population of women diagnosed with stage 1 USC. Due to the scarcity of prospective or large-scale data, studies were not limited by design or numbers of patients. Studies performed at earlier dates were incorporated to provide context. RESULTS A total of 86 studies were included in the review. Multiple well-designed studies have confirmed the safety of a minimally invasive surgical approach for surgical management of USC. The role of sentinel node biopsy has been validated with both prospective and retrospective multi-center data. Stage I USC is associated with a highly variable risk of recurrence, even following completion of adjuvant chemoradiation. This aggressive phenotype has been linked to high numbers of somatic copy number alterations, tumor protein 53, and phosphatidylinositol 3 kinase mutations, which have been shown to be predictive of prognosis. CONCLUSION Early-stage USC demonstrates a lack of predictable recurrence patterns, with reports noting distant recurrence in patients with disease confined to polyps. Unless no residual tumor is found on hysterectomy, chemotherapy and radiotherapy should be discussed and individualized by stage and treatment goals.

ESGO/ESTRO/ESP guidelines for the management of patients with endometrial carcinoma. Radiother Oncol 2021; 154:327-353. Abstract
A European consensus conference on endometrial carcinoma was held in 2014 to produce multidisciplinary evidence-based guidelines on selected questions. Given the large body of literature on the management of endometrial carcinoma published since 2014, the European Society of Gynaecological Oncology (ESGO), the European SocieTy for Radiotherapy & Oncology (ESTRO) and the European Society of Pathology (ESP) jointly decided to update these evidence-based guidelines and to cover new topics in order to improve the quality of care for women with endometrial carcinoma across Europe and worldwide. ESGO/ESTRO/ESP nominated an international multidisciplinary development group consisting of practicing clinicians and researchers who have demonstrated leadership and expertise in the care and research of endometrial carcinoma (27 experts across Europe). To ensure that the guidelines are evidence-based, the literature published since 2014, identified from a systematic search was reviewed and critically appraised. In the absence of any clear scientific evidence, judgment was based on the professional experience and consensus of the development group. The guidelines are thus based on the best available evidence and expert agreement. Prior to publication, the guidelines were reviewed by 191 independent international practitioners in cancer care delivery and patient representatives. The guidelines comprehensively cover endometrial carcinoma staging, definition of prognostic risk groups integrating molecular markers, pre- and intra-operative work-up, fertility preservation, management for early, advanced, metastatic, and recurrent disease and palliative treatment. Principles of radiotherapy and pathological evaluation are also defined.

Sentinel lymph node intraoperative analysis in endometrial cancer. J Cancer Res Clin Oncol 2020; 146:3199-3205. Abstract
PURPOSE Surgical staging in endometrial cancer has evolved and sentinel lymph node (SLN) mapping has replaced a full pelvic and paraaortic lymphadenectomy in several cases. An intraoperative evaluation of SLN might identify patients who could benefit the most from a full lymphadenectomy. The aim of this study is to evaluate the clinical relevance of frozen section of SLN. METHODS A retrospective analysis in patients with endometrial cancer who underwent SLN mapping with intraoperative evaluation at frozen section between February 2016 and September 2019 was performed. In case of metastatic involvement, a full lymphadenectomy was performed. RESULTS Fifty-eight patients met the inclusion criteria. Clinical-pathologic characteristics of the patients and surgical data were analyzed. Overall, bilateral and unilateral detection rates were 100% (58/58), 89.7% (52/58), and 10.3% (6/58), respectively. Eight patients had a stage IIIC disease at permanent section. Frozen section detected SLN metastases in four of eight patients. Of these, two were micrometastases and two were macrometastases. At frozen section of the SLNs, no macrometastases were misdiagnosed. Sensitivity, specificity, accuracy, positive predictive value and negative predictive value of frozen section in detecting metastases was 50%, 100%, 93%, 100% and 92.6%, respectively. CONCLUSION The intraoperative evaluation of SLN in endometrial cancer accurately identifies patients with macrometastases. This is the cohort that might benefit the most of a full lymphadenectomy for a higher risk of additional lymph node metastases.

Moukarzel LA, Feinberg J, Levy EJ, Leitao MM. Current and novel mapping substances in gynecologic cancer care. Int J Gynecol Cancer 2020; 30:387-393. Abstract
Many tracers have been introduced into current medical practice with the purpose of improving lymphatic mapping techniques, anatomic visualization, and organ/tissue perfusion assessment. Among them, three tracers have dominated the field: indocyanine green, technetium-99m radiocolloid (Tc99m), and blue dye. Tc99m and blue dye are used individually or in combination; however, given particular challenges with these tracers, such as the need for a preoperative procedure by nuclear medicine and cost, other options have been sought. Indocyanine green has proven to be a promising alternative for certain procedures, as it is easy to use and has quick uptake. Its use in the management of gynecologic cancers was first described for sentinel lymph node mapping in cervical cancer, and later for endometrial and vulvar cancers. This review provides an in-depth look at these mapping substances, their uses, and the potential for new discoveries.

Abdelazim IA, Abu-Faza M, Zhurabekova G, Shikanova S, Karimova B, Sarsembayev M, Starchenko T, Mukhambetalyeva G. Sentinel Lymph Nodes in Endometrial Cancer Update 2018. Gynecol Minim Invasive Ther 2019; 8:94-100. Abstract
There are no established data about lymphadenectomy during treatment of endometrial cancers (ECs) and to what extent lymphadenectomy should be performed. In addition, retroperitoneal lymphadenectomy increases the intraoperative and postoperative complications. Sentinel lymph node (SLN) mapping has the lowest costs and highest quality-adjusted survival. SLN is the most cost-effective strategy in the management of low-risk ECs. Women staged with SLN mapping were more likely to receive adjuvant treatment compared with women staged with systemic lymphadenectomy. This review article designed to evaluate the diagnostic accuracy and the methods of SLN detection in ECs.

Triple tracer (blue dye, indocyanine green, and Tc99) compared to double tracer (indocyanine green and Tc99) for sentinel lymph node detection in endometrial cancer: a prospective study with random assignment. Int J Gynecol Cancer 2019; 29:1121-1125. Abstract
OBJECTIVE Sentinel lymph node (SLN) mapping is increasingly being used in the treatment of apparent early-stage endometrial cancer. The aim of this study was to evaluate whether three tracers (blue dye, indocyanine green (ICG), and technetium-99 (Tc99)) performed better than two (ICG and Tc99). STUDY DESIGN Prospective study of all consecutive patients (n=163) diagnosed with clinical early-stage endometrial cancer from 2015 to 2017. All patients were randomly assigned to receive a mixture of ICG and Tc99 with or without blue dye. Subgroup analysis for detection rates was performed for each group (double versus triple tracer). RESULTS One hundred and fifty-seven patients met the inclusion criteria. Eighty patients received ICG and Tc99 with unilateral and bilateral SLN detection rates of 97.5% and 81.3%, respectively. Seventy-seven patients received all three tracers with unilateral and bilateral detection rates of 93.5% and 80.5%, respectively. Only one patient in the triple tracer group was detected by blue dye alone. No significant differences were noticed in unilateral or bilateral detection rates between the two groups, nor in the detection of lymph node metastasis. CONCLUSION The addition of blue dye to ICG and Tc99 did not demonstrate any improvement in SLN detection.

Fernández-Bautista B, Mata DP, Parente A, Pérez-Caballero R, De Agustín JC. First Experience with Fluorescence in Pediatric Laparoscopy. European J Pediatr Surg Rep 2019; 7:e43-e46. Abstract
Background
The use of intraoperative fluorescence images with indocyanine green (ICG) has recently been described as an aid in decision-making during surgical procedures in adults.
We present our first experiences with different laparoscopic procedures performed in children using ICG fluorescence images. Material and Method
We have used ICG fluorescence imaging technique in varicocele ligation, two nephrectomies, cholecystectomy, and one case of aortocoronary fistula closure. All procedures were performed through a minimally invasive approach. A high definition camera equipped with a visible infrared light source and gray-scale vision technology was used.
After injection of ICG before or during the laparoscopic procedure, precise identification of vascular anatomy and bile duct architecture were easily identified. Fluorescence helped to assess blood flow from the spermatic vessels, define the variability of renal vascularization, and determine the precise location of the aortocoronary fistula. Biliary excretion of the ICG allowed the definition of the biliary tract. Conclusion
Fluorescein-assisted images allowed a clear definition of the anatomy and safe surgical maneuvers during surgical procedures. The ICG imaging system seems to be simple and safe. Larger and more specific studies are needed to confirm its applicability, expand its indications, and address its advantages and disadvantages.

Gasparri ML, Caserta D, Benedetti Panici P, Papadia A, Mueller MD. Surgical staging in endometrial cancer. J Cancer Res Clin Oncol 2018; 145:213-221. Abstract
In several malignancies, it has been demonstrated that the lymph nodal status is the most important pathologic factor affecting prognosis and giving the indication to further adjuvant treatment. The surgical assessment of the lymph nodal status in endometrial cancer is debated since 30 years. Recently, the sentinel lymph node mapping is rapidly gaining clinical acceptance in endometrial cancer. The adoption of Indocyanine Green as a safe and user friendly tracer for sentinel lymph node mapping increased the speed to which this procedure is getting applied in clinical practice. As a consequence of this rapid growth, several fundamental questions have been raised and are still debatable. In this manuscript, we discuss the importance of a known pathological lymph nodal status, the technique of the sentinel lymph node mapping with the reported false negative rates and detection rates according to the different tracers adopted, and the clinical scenarios in which a sentinel lymph node mapping could be employed.

Papadia A, Gasparri ML, Wang J, Radan AP, Mueller MD. Sentinel node biopsy for treatment of endometrial cancer: current perspectives. ACTA ACUST UNITED AC 2018; 71:25-35. Abstract
The risk of lymph nodal metastases in endometrial cancer varies greatly according to the characteristics of the primary tumor. Surgical staging with a systematic lymphadenectomy in endometrial cancer is debated since three decades. On one hand, it provides important pathological information on the spread of the tumor allowing for an appropriate decision making on adjuvant treatment but on the other side it is characterized by a non-negligible short and long-term morbidity. In the past decade, various efforts have been made in the attempt to apply the concept of the sentinel lymph node mapping in endometrial cancer. The sentinel lymph node mapping has the potential to provide the necessary pathological lymph nodal information at a reasonable cost in terms of morbidity. In this review, the most relevant aspects of the sentinel lymph node mapping in endometrial cancer are summarized. Furthermore, the performance in terms of false negative rates and detection rates, the clinical value of the pathological ultrastaging, its clinical applicability in different scenarios including patients preoperatively considered to be at low or at high risk are discussed. Oncological outcome of the patients who have been submitted to a sentinel lymph node mapping as compared to a full lymhadenectomy are presented as well as technical aspects to improve the performance of the surgical technique.
